46
Bioinformatics Grid-based Bioinformatics Grid-based Applications and IOIT-HCM Grid Applications and IOIT-HCM Grid Tran Van Lang, Do Van Long Tran Van Lang, Do Van Long Members of VNGrid Project Members of VNGrid Project HCM City Institute of Information HCM City Institute of Information Technology (IOIT-HCM, VAST) Technology (IOIT-HCM, VAST)

Bioinformatics Grid-based Applications and IOIT-HCM Grid

  • Upload
    lila-le

  • View
    29

  • Download
    1

Embed Size (px)

DESCRIPTION

Bioinformatics Grid-based Applications and IOIT-HCM Grid. Tran Van Lang, Do Van Long Members of VNGrid Project HCM City Institute of Information Technology (IOIT-HCM, VAST). IOIT-HCM Introduction. Ho Chi Minh City Institute of Information Technology (IOIT-HCM, VAST). 2001-2002. 2003. - PowerPoint PPT Presentation

Citation preview

Page 1: Bioinformatics Grid-based Applications and IOIT-HCM Grid

Bioinformatics Grid-based Bioinformatics Grid-based Applications and IOIT-HCM GridApplications and IOIT-HCM Grid

Tran Van Lang, Do Van LongTran Van Lang, Do Van LongMembers of VNGrid ProjectMembers of VNGrid Project

HCM City Institute of Information HCM City Institute of Information Technology (IOIT-HCM, VAST)Technology (IOIT-HCM, VAST)

Page 2: Bioinformatics Grid-based Applications and IOIT-HCM Grid

IOIT-HCM IntroductionIOIT-HCM Introduction

Ho Chi Minh City Institute of Ho Chi Minh City Institute of Information Technology Information Technology

(IOIT-HCM, VAST)(IOIT-HCM, VAST)

Page 3: Bioinformatics Grid-based Applications and IOIT-HCM Grid

History of IOIT-HCM GridHistory of IOIT-HCM Grid

2003 2004 20052001-2002

Conference on HPC and Grid Computing, in HCM City, held by Ministry of Science

and Technology

The Centers and systems for HPC were

founded

IOIT-HCM Grid Project

HCM City UT Grid Project

BK Grid Group,

Hanoi UT

Grid Group of HCM City College Natural

Sciences

BioGrid, IOIT-HCM

2006-2007

IOIT-HCM connect to

Pragma

VNGrid Project

Page 4: Bioinformatics Grid-based Applications and IOIT-HCM Grid

IOIT-HCM join to PragmaIOIT-HCM join to Pragma

Page 5: Bioinformatics Grid-based Applications and IOIT-HCM Grid

PHÂN VIỆN CÔNG NGHỆ PHÂN VIỆN CÔNG NGHỆ THÔNG TIN TẠI TP. HỒ CHÍ THÔNG TIN TẠI TP. HỒ CHÍ

MINH (IOIT-HCM)MINH (IOIT-HCM) 55

Page 6: Bioinformatics Grid-based Applications and IOIT-HCM Grid

PHÂN VIỆN CÔNG NGHỆ PHÂN VIỆN CÔNG NGHỆ THÔNG TIN TẠI TP. HỒ CHÍ THÔNG TIN TẠI TP. HỒ CHÍ

MINH (IOIT-HCM)MINH (IOIT-HCM) 66

IOIT-HCM Grid resource IOIT-HCM Grid resource monitormonitor

Page 7: Bioinformatics Grid-based Applications and IOIT-HCM Grid

PHÂN VIỆN CÔNG NGHỆ PHÂN VIỆN CÔNG NGHỆ THÔNG TIN TẠI TP. HỒ CHÍ THÔNG TIN TẠI TP. HỒ CHÍ

MINH (IOIT-HCM)MINH (IOIT-HCM) 77

Page 8: Bioinformatics Grid-based Applications and IOIT-HCM Grid

PHÂN VIỆN CÔNG NGHỆ PHÂN VIỆN CÔNG NGHỆ THÔNG TIN TẠI TP. HỒ CHÍ THÔNG TIN TẠI TP. HỒ CHÍ

MINH (IOIT-HCM)MINH (IOIT-HCM) 88

Page 9: Bioinformatics Grid-based Applications and IOIT-HCM Grid

99

Applications and Middleware Applications and Middleware in Pragma testbedin Pragma testbed

http://goc.pragma-grid.net/applications/default.html

Real science applications pair and drive Real science applications pair and drive middleware developmentmiddleware development

Achieve long-run and scientific resultsAchieve long-run and scientific results Open to applications of all scientific disciplinesOpen to applications of all scientific disciplines

Climate simulationClimate simulation Savannah/Nimrod (MU, Australia)Savannah/Nimrod (MU, Australia) MM5/Mpich-Gx (CICESE, Mexico; KISTI, MM5/Mpich-Gx (CICESE, Mexico; KISTI,

Korea)Korea) Quantum-mechanics, quantum-chemistry:Quantum-mechanics, quantum-chemistry:

TDDFT, QM-MD, FMO/Ninf-G (AIST, Japan)TDDFT, QM-MD, FMO/Ninf-G (AIST, Japan) GenomicsGenomics

iGAP/Gfarm/CSF (UCSD, USA; AIST, Japan; iGAP/Gfarm/CSF (UCSD, USA; AIST, Japan; JLU, China)JLU, China)

HPM: genomics (IOIT-HCM, Vietnam)HPM: genomics (IOIT-HCM, Vietnam) mpiBlast/Mpich-G2 (ASGC, Taiwan)mpiBlast/Mpich-G2 (ASGC, Taiwan)

Organic chemistryOrganic chemistry Gamess-APBS/Nimrod (UZurich, Gamess-APBS/Nimrod (UZurich,

Switzerland)Switzerland) Molecular simulationMolecular simulation

Siesta/Nimrod (UZurich, Switzerland; MU, Siesta/Nimrod (UZurich, Switzerland; MU, Australia)Australia)

Amber/Rsh ( USM, Malaysia)Amber/Rsh ( USM, Malaysia) Computer ScienceComputer Science

Load Balancer (IOIT-HCM, Vietnam)Load Balancer (IOIT-HCM, Vietnam) GriddLeS (MU, Australia)GriddLeS (MU, Australia)

2 applications from Vietnam2 applications from Vietnam

Page 10: Bioinformatics Grid-based Applications and IOIT-HCM Grid

IOIT-HCM Grid MembersIOIT-HCM Grid Members

Page 11: Bioinformatics Grid-based Applications and IOIT-HCM Grid

PHÂN VIỆN CÔNG NGHỆ PHÂN VIỆN CÔNG NGHỆ THÔNG TIN TẠI TP. HỒ CHÍ THÔNG TIN TẠI TP. HỒ CHÍ

MINH (IOIT-HCM)MINH (IOIT-HCM) 1111

Infrastructure of IOIT-HCM Grid SystemInfrastructure of IOIT-HCM Grid System

Ethernet – 1 GbpsEthernet –10 Mbps

Ethernet 1 Gbps

Internet

172.25.100.2 172.25.100.3 172.25.100.5

172.25.100.1

172.25.101.2 172.25.101.3

172.25.101.1

172.25.97.28203.162.99.117

172.25.97.30203.162.99.98

172.25.98.118203.162.99.118

172.25.97.10203.162.99.116

biogrid.ioit-hcm.ac.vn bio.ioit-hcm.ac.vn

moon.ioit-hcm.ac.vn

Head Node (Condor)

Head Node(Condor)

Grid Portal Database

Compute Node Compute Node

CA

Ethernet – 100 Mbps

Head NodeCA (SGE)

172.25.97.29

Compute Node

172.25.102.2 172.25.102.3

172.25.102.4

172.25.102.5

172.25.102.1

venus.ioit-hcm.ac.vn

IOIT-HCM LAN

Page 12: Bioinformatics Grid-based Applications and IOIT-HCM Grid

PHÂN VIỆN CÔNG NGHỆ PHÂN VIỆN CÔNG NGHỆ THÔNG TIN TẠI TP. HỒ CHÍ THÔNG TIN TẠI TP. HỒ CHÍ

MINH (IOIT-HCM)MINH (IOIT-HCM) 1212

Network architecture of Grid System Network architecture of Grid System connect to KISTI, PRAGMA and VASTconnect to KISTI, PRAGMA and VAST

Internet

Compute Nodes

Ethernet

PBS

Ethernet

SGE

proliant.vast-hcm.ac.vn

198.202.88.52

150.183.249.14

rocks-52.sdsc.edu

Compute Nodes

Ethernet

Ethernet

jupiter.gridcenter.or.kr

210.86.238.85

SGE

IOIT-HCM Grid

Page 13: Bioinformatics Grid-based Applications and IOIT-HCM Grid

Grid-based applicationsGrid-based applications

Page 14: Bioinformatics Grid-based Applications and IOIT-HCM Grid

1414

IOIT-HCM Grid PortalIOIT-HCM Grid Portal

Our Grid Portal based on Our Grid Portal based on opensource packages:opensource packages: Globus Toolkit 4 Globus Toolkit 4 Java CoGJava CoG Jetspeed PortalJetspeed Portal Tomcat Tomcat Jboss Jboss PostgresqlPostgresql Condor GCondor G GridPort4GridPort4 GridSphere Framework with GridSphere Framework with

JSR168-compatible Portlet JSR168-compatible Portlet ContainerContainer

Page 15: Bioinformatics Grid-based Applications and IOIT-HCM Grid

BioScienceBioScience Gird Portal Gird Portal

Resource monitoring in a gridResource monitoring in a grid Proxy managementProxy management File managementFile management Job specification and execution Job specification and execution

Building Bioinformatics tools with Grid Technology Building Bioinformatics tools with Grid Technology apply on Grid Portal: apply on Grid Portal: Multiple sequences alignmentMultiple sequences alignment Phylogenetics TreePhylogenetics Tree BlastBlast Motif findingMotif finding Protein Structure PredictionProtein Structure Prediction

Page 16: Bioinformatics Grid-based Applications and IOIT-HCM Grid

Grid PortalGrid Portal

Page 17: Bioinformatics Grid-based Applications and IOIT-HCM Grid

Gird computing apply for generating the Phylogenetic Tree

1

2

3

4

5

3

2

Align a sequence to a profile

Align a profile to a profile

Align a sequence to a sequence

11

2

3

4

5

3

2

Align a sequence to a profile

Align a profile to a profile

Align a sequence to a sequence

1

Page 18: Bioinformatics Grid-based Applications and IOIT-HCM Grid
Page 19: Bioinformatics Grid-based Applications and IOIT-HCM Grid

IOIT-HCM Grid Portal - Blast deploying

Page 20: Bioinformatics Grid-based Applications and IOIT-HCM Grid

Motif findingMotif finding Programming in MPI-2 apply on IOIT-HCM Grid Sys

tem

Page 21: Bioinformatics Grid-based Applications and IOIT-HCM Grid

Protein Structure predictionProtein Structure prediction Programming in MPI-2 with Molecular Dynamic (MD)

Algorithm

Page 22: Bioinformatics Grid-based Applications and IOIT-HCM Grid

Access Grid deploymentAccess Grid deployment

Access Grid for Access Grid for collaboration the collaboration the multimedia data multimedia data ((IOIT-HCMIOIT-HCM):):Support ting to the Support ting to the Conference on IT and Conference on IT and Communication in Communication in Haiphong, Vietnam Haiphong, Vietnam (10/2005)(10/2005)

Page 23: Bioinformatics Grid-based Applications and IOIT-HCM Grid

Meeting Room 1 2nd Floor – Block 1

Meeting Room 32nd Floor – Block 2

Meeting Room 21st Floor – Block 2

Center Room1st Floor – Block 1

Page 24: Bioinformatics Grid-based Applications and IOIT-HCM Grid
Page 25: Bioinformatics Grid-based Applications and IOIT-HCM Grid
Page 26: Bioinformatics Grid-based Applications and IOIT-HCM Grid

TelemedicineTelemedicine

Page 27: Bioinformatics Grid-based Applications and IOIT-HCM Grid

Telemedicine Conference on 05/05/05 Telemedicine Conference on 05/05/05 Hospital of Medical (HCM) vs. VietDuc Hospital (Ha Hospital of Medical (HCM) vs. VietDuc Hospital (Ha

Noi)Noi)

Page 28: Bioinformatics Grid-based Applications and IOIT-HCM Grid

Conference between BenTre Province Leaders with University of Medical (HCM)Conference between BenTre Province Leaders with University of Medical (HCM)Deploying Telemedicine with AccessGrid Technology from IOIT-HCMDeploying Telemedicine with AccessGrid Technology from IOIT-HCM

Page 29: Bioinformatics Grid-based Applications and IOIT-HCM Grid

Telemedicine between Nhi Dong 1 Hospital (HCM) Telemedicine between Nhi Dong 1 Hospital (HCM) and Nguyen Dinh Chieu (Ben Tre Province)and Nguyen Dinh Chieu (Ben Tre Province)

Deploying Telemedicine with Video Conferencing Technology from IOIT-HCMDeploying Telemedicine with Video Conferencing Technology from IOIT-HCM

Page 30: Bioinformatics Grid-based Applications and IOIT-HCM Grid
Page 31: Bioinformatics Grid-based Applications and IOIT-HCM Grid
Page 32: Bioinformatics Grid-based Applications and IOIT-HCM Grid

Setup the e-Learning system for Setup the e-Learning system for training on Girdtraining on Gird

2nd Training Course on Functional Genomics of Insect Vector of Human diseases - Oct 2005, Malaria Research Center, Bamako, Africa (support from NIH, US)

Page 33: Bioinformatics Grid-based Applications and IOIT-HCM Grid

Elearning system of IOIT-HCM deploy in Bamako, Mali, AficaElearning system of IOIT-HCM deploy in Bamako, Mali, Afica

Page 34: Bioinformatics Grid-based Applications and IOIT-HCM Grid

Bioinformatics Courses with NCBI

NLM – National Library Medical Training ClassNIH, US

Page 35: Bioinformatics Grid-based Applications and IOIT-HCM Grid

Research for deploy Grid System in Research for deploy Grid System in South Provinces of VietnamSouth Provinces of Vietnam

Connecting from HCM to Can Tho University

Page 36: Bioinformatics Grid-based Applications and IOIT-HCM Grid

Connecting from HCM to An Giang University

Page 37: Bioinformatics Grid-based Applications and IOIT-HCM Grid

Avian Flu Observer research to deploy on Avian Flu Observer research to deploy on GridGrid

Page 38: Bioinformatics Grid-based Applications and IOIT-HCM Grid

Vietnam Digital Map research to deploy on Vietnam Digital Map research to deploy on GridGrid

Page 39: Bioinformatics Grid-based Applications and IOIT-HCM Grid

Join to the Grid CommunitiesJoin to the Grid Communities

1.1. GeoGrid, Pragma 12: GeoGrid, Pragma 12: ThailandThailand (03/2007) (03/2007)

2.2. ISGC 07: ISGC 07: TaipeiTaipei (03/2007) (03/2007)

3.3. EGEE User Forum: EGEE User Forum: ManchesterManchester (05/2007) (05/2007)

4.4. AsiaGrid: AsiaGrid: SingaporeSingapore (06/2007) (06/2007)

5.5. APAN Meeting: APAN Meeting: ChinaChina (08/2007) (08/2007)

6.6. EGEE Meeting: EGEE Meeting: PudapestPudapest (10/2007) (10/2007)

7.7. Grid Camp: Grid Camp: TaipeiTaipei (11/2007) (11/2007)

8.8. Do Son School: Do Son School: VietnamVietnam (11/2007) (11/2007)

9.9. ……

Page 40: Bioinformatics Grid-based Applications and IOIT-HCM Grid

Join to the Grid Communities (cont.)Join to the Grid Communities (cont.)

Fragma 12 – Thailand, Mar 2007

ISGC 2007 – Taipei, Apr 2007

Page 41: Bioinformatics Grid-based Applications and IOIT-HCM Grid

EGEE User Forum, England ,EGEE User Forum, England ,

May 2007May 2007AsiaGrid – Singapore, AsiaGrid – Singapore,

Jun 2007Jun 2007

Page 42: Bioinformatics Grid-based Applications and IOIT-HCM Grid

International IT Conference 10th ,Vietnam, Sep 200724th APAN Meeting- Xian, China

Aug 2007

Page 43: Bioinformatics Grid-based Applications and IOIT-HCM Grid

EGEE Meeting: EGEE Meeting: PudapestPudapest (10/2007)(10/2007) Grid Camp: Grid Camp: TaipeiTaipei (11/2007) (11/2007)

Page 44: Bioinformatics Grid-based Applications and IOIT-HCM Grid

Future step: Setup Grid on VinaRen Future step: Setup Grid on VinaRen NetworkNetwork

Page 45: Bioinformatics Grid-based Applications and IOIT-HCM Grid

Finished test TEIN2 Connection from VNU Ha Noi to IOIT-HCM

Page 46: Bioinformatics Grid-based Applications and IOIT-HCM Grid

4646

ConclusionConclusion Studying Grid Technology and try to Studying Grid Technology and try to

apply to Science and Education. apply to Science and Education. Will invest more for the networking and Will invest more for the networking and

infrastructure infrastructure Need to connect to the other Grid Need to connect to the other Grid

System for expand the collaboration.System for expand the collaboration. Need more supporting to developNeed more supporting to develop

Our next step is connecting to EGEE Asia Federation (EAF) Our next step is connecting to EGEE Asia Federation (EAF) to receive the operations technology and experience for to receive the operations technology and experience for deploying e-Science on our Grid Resource Centers.deploying e-Science on our Grid Resource Centers.